基于DDS的AM调制器设计.docx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

电子线路综合设计

基于DDS的AM调制器设计

2010/3/27

目录

TOC\o1-3\h\z\u摘要及关键字 2

设计要求说明 2

方案论证 2

直接数字频率合成(DDS)部分 2

AM调制部分 3

各子模块设计 3

DDS的设计(无ROM模块) 3

LPM-ROM的设定 4

AM调制模块 5

频率计的设计 7

实现节省ROM空间的模块设计(四分之一波形) 9

方案编译、仿真和下载 10

实验中遇到的问题及解决方法 11

实验的收获及感悟 11

参考文献 11

摘要及关键字

摘要:利用QuartusII7.0、MATLAB以及SmartSOPC实验系统进行基于DDS的AM调制器的设计是本次试验的主要内容。整个电路要求能够产生数字的音频信号和载波信号,再将这两个信号进行AM调制,最后通过D/A转换器经示波器观察波形,同时设计一频率计测量音频信号与载波信号的频率。

Abstract:QuartusII7.0,MATLAB,andSmartSOPCexperimentalsystemforthedesignofDDS-basedAMmodulatoristhemaincontentofthetrial.Theentirecircuitisrequiredtoproducedigitalaudiosignalsandcarriersignal,andthenthetwosignals,AMmodulation,thefinaladoptionofD/Aconverterwaveformobservedbytheoscilloscope,andafrequencycounterdesignedtomeasuretheaudiosignalandthecarriersignalfrequency.

关键字:DDS,AM,SmartSOPC,Quartus,VHDL,LPM-ROM,频率计

Keywords:DDS,AM,SmartSOPC,Quartus,VHDL,LPM-ROM,FrequencyCounter

设计要求说明

利用Quartus软件和SmartSOPC实验箱实现DDS的设计。

利用其他软件新建ROM宏单元初始化文件*.mif。

DDS中的波形存储器模块用Altera公司的Cyclone系列FPGA芯片中的ROM实现,设计数据个数为4096,数据宽度为10位。

设计基于DDS的载波信号产生电路和调制信号产生电路,要求载波信号和调制信号的频率分别可调。

设计测频电路,要求可以测试载波信号和调制信号的频率并可以分别显示。

用VHDL语言设计该电路中加法和乘法功能模块。

采用混合输入法连接各功能模块,完成整体电路设计。利用实验箱上的D/A转换器将最后乘法运算电路输出的数字信号转换为模拟信号,能够通过示波器观察到波形。

对AM调制电路进行仿真,记录AM仿真波形。

利用示波器观察mA

尝试通过存储四分之一波形进入ROM而同样能生成完整的正弦波。

方案论证

直接数字频率合成(DDS)部分

DDS即DirectDigitalSynthesizer数字合成器,是一种新型的频率合成技术。具有相对带宽大、频率转换时间段、分辨力高、相位连续性好等优点,很容易实现频率、相位和幅度的数控调制,其基本结构图如下所示:

累加寄存器

累加寄存器

ROM模块

频率字输入

FWORD

N

N

相位字输入

M

M

信号输出

Clock

累加寄存器的工作流程如下:每当一个抽样时钟脉冲到来时,数字全加器将上个时钟周期内寄存器所存的值与FWORD相加,其和存入寄存器作为累加器的当前值输出。当寄存器存满时,产生一次溢出使累加器置零,从而完成一个周期的动作。在累加寄存器中,如果采用N位字长的数字寄存器来存储正弦波形一个周期内的抽样后的离散相位,这实际上是对0,2π的相位区间进行间隔为12N的线性量化,累加器的累加周期即是DDS合成信号的一个周期,包含2

累加寄存器的结果再与相位控制字(PWORD)相加,结果作为ROM的相位取样地址,这样就可以通过改变相位控制字实现调相。ROM中有生成号的波形抽样值,可完成相位到幅度的转换。

AM调制部分

在标准幅度调制器(AM)中,设载波信号为:vct=

vAMt=[Vcm+vft]cosω

=[Vcm+VΩmcosΩt

=Vcm[1+mAcosΩt]cosω

其中:mA=VΩm/Vcm被成为调幅度,是调幅信号的一个重要参数,一般小于1,当其大于1时会

文档评论(0)

寒傲似冰 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

版权声明书
用户编号:8071104010000026

1亿VIP精品文档

相关文档